Day Cruise - Queenstown - Starting from $39.00 per person
Enjoy exploring New Zealand’s gorgeous Lake Wakatipu on a catamaran cruise from Queenstown. Surrounded by stunning mountains including the Remarkables and the Southern Alps, Lake Wakatipu is New Zealand's longest lake and a highlight of Queenstown. Your captain provides informative commentary about the sights and wildlife around the lake as you cruise to the western shore to take in the stunning scenery. Choose from a selection of morning and afternoon cruises to fit your schedule. More... |

Helicopter Tour - Wanaka - Starting from $395.00 per person
Your 35-minute helicopter flight provides a once-in-a-lifetime experience to step on an ancient Glacier at 7,000 ft (2,300m) with breathtaking views across Mount Aspiring National Park. Your flight takes you from the Matukituki Valley above extensive valleys carved out by glaciers thousands of years ago across snow capped peaks to land on a glacier with stunning 360-degree views of the surrounding Southern Alps.
